All,
I'm in the USA, using an SE 580i. I've just started working on converting and transferring video to the phone using the M3 software I read such great things about at this forum. So far I'm converting .avi files only - pending purchase of a 4GB memory stick.
I'm wondering:
> what phone to select from the drop down menu in M3 - cos mine isn't listed
> how to set a specific size of the output file
Any tips at all regarding how to attain optimum quality using the M3 converter for my W580i are greatly appreciated in advance.

I think you can use the Phone Model W850 or K800 because it has the same pixel 320 x 240 and just select other settings
